Description"Looking from woods towards White's factory. Study of birches. " written on back of photo. (William) White's Factory was a (complex of) cotton and woolen mill(s) owned and managed by the White Brothers. It was located on the edge of the Acushnet River in Acushnet, south of Wheldon's Factory and by the White Factory Rd.On View
